Nationally Accredited

Grace Compassion Home Health (Gradark Compassion Care, Inc.) is proud to be accredited by CHAP, (Community Health Accreditation Program) the independent, nonprofit, accrediting body for community-based health care organizations. It is the oldest national community-based accrediting body with more than 8,300 sites currently accredited. CHAP has the regulatory authority to survey agencies providing home health services to determine if they meet the Medicare Conditions of Participation and CMS Quality Standards. CHAP’s purpose is to define and advance the highest quality of community-based care for families in need of reliable and caring home health services.

Dedicated, Reliable Professionals

Each one of their certified nursing and therapeutic staff members are thoroughly screened via criminal reference checks, state mandated certification checks, personality evaluations and licensure reviews before they are hired. In addition, they look for employees who are willing to go the extra mile in making sure each patient’s needs are met. They also encourage their staff to attend continuing education programs on an annual basis.

After meeting with the patient and their family, they carefully select the best caregiver to meet their needs and personality over the course of their treatment and rehabilitation, thereby reducing confusion, and establishing consistency throughout the relationship.

Advanced Clinical Services
Grace Compassion Home Health Agency specializes in helping patients stay in their homes while they receive medical treatment. They are often called upon to assist patients in their transition from a hospital or nursing home who need continuous support to prevent interruptions or setbacks in their recovery.

They have the expertise to handle a wide variety of clinical needs on both a short-term and long term basis. Their critical care certified nurses that are certified for cardiac illnesses are comfortable supporting patients with LVAD’s, home cardiac monitoring, CHF (Congestive Heart Failure), respiratory and other cardiac issues. In addition, there clinical team is experienced with tracheostomy care and wound management.

Patients recovering from, or recently diagnosed with illnesses, as well as patients recovering from procedures or surgery, often experience depression, increased anxiety, changes in behavior, and appetite. Their team understands these challenges and are prepared to offer the support necessary to help the patient and family make a successful transition, and continue with care or recovery as well as assistance with daily living activities, including household services and companion care services.
